I just got a king quad 700 2007 and I rode it for about 5 hours the other day and at the end of the day all the sudden it would not come out of 4 wheel drive. Also the diff will not lock now, it just flashes. The button is functioning and I pulled it apart and its clean so its not gummed up. Anyone ever experience this and know how to fix it. Loosen the bolts that mount the front diff and just kinda tap it. Somtimes they bind up a bit. Then tightened it back down
